
我们常常会遇到一些问题,比如pandas.dataframe如何根据条件新建列并赋值等问题,我们该怎么处理呢。下面这篇文章将为你提供一个解决思路,希望能帮你解决到相关问题。
1. 导入pandas库
首先,我们需要导入Pandas库,以便使用DataFrame类:
import pandas as pd
2. 创建DataFrame
接下来,我们可以使用DataFrame类创建一个DataFrame,它可以是一个空的DataFrame,也可以是一个已经存在的DataFrame:
df = pd.DataFrame()
3. 根据条件新增列并赋值
我们可以使用DataFrame类的assign()方法,根据一个或多个条件,新增一列并赋值:
df = df.assign(new_column_name = lambda x: x.column_name1 + x.column_name2)
上面的代码会根据column_name1和column_name2的值,计算出新列new_column_name的值,并赋值给DataFrame。
总结
以上就是为你整理的pandas.dataframe如何根据条件新建列并赋值全部内容,希望文章能够帮你解决相关问题,更多请关注本站相关栏目的其它相关文章!